Abstract
The invention relates to a projection display that operates in a multi-channel manner to reflect an image to be displayed into the view of an occupant of a means of transportation. By means of this approach the construction size can be reduced, because the focal lengths of the optical units of the individual channels can be significantly smaller, which in turn also enables a weight reduction of the system. Because of the multi-channel nature, the susceptibility of the projection display to curvatures of the reflection surface is also reduced, which relieves the burden on the corrective measures and thus can reduce the installation scope and/or the quality of the reflected image. The reflection can also be adapted in a simple manner to the current situation of the occupant of the means of transportation.
